Citibank Account Frozen After Withdrawal – $5050 Transfer Issue Needs Resolution

15

I recently withdrew $5050 from my Citibank account outside of business hours, and my account was subsequently frozen. I was informed that to resolve this issue, I would need to deposit an additional $5050 into my account, which I find completely unreasonable.

It has now been two days, and I still cannot access my money. Despite my efforts, I am unable to get consistent help from customer service. This situation is causing me significant stress and inconvenience, as I urgently need access to my funds.

I request Citibank to resolve this matter immediately and transfer my funds without delay. Customers should not face such unnecessary obstacles when managing their own accounts. Prompt action is required.
